 This photo from 1894 shows the students who attended the Goodman-Perrill Road one room school. The school building is visible in the background of the photo. Grant Watkins, who as an adult would become renowned for his skills as a cowboy and champion sheep shearer, is pictured here at age 11 on the top row second from the left. Also pictured here, second from the left in the second row, is Pearl Watkins, who would become a successful Madison Township farmer. The other children in the photo are unidentified.
